One of the main reasons why commercial electrical repair is so important is safety. Faulty wiring, overloaded circuits, and other electrical issues can pose serious risks to employees, customers, and the building itself. In some cases, these issues can even lead to fires, electrocutions, and other disasters. By hiring a qualified electrician to perform regular maintenance and repairs, businesses can help prevent these risks and create a safer work environment for everyone.
In addition to safety concerns, commercial electrical repair is also important for ensuring that businesses can operate efficiently. When electrical systems are not functioning properly, it can lead to power outages, equipment malfunctions, and other disruptions that can hinder productivity. For businesses that rely on electricity to power critical systems, such as servers or manufacturing equipment, even a brief outage can result in significant financial losses. By addressing electrical problems quickly and effectively, businesses can minimize downtime and keep their operations running smoothly.
Another key reason why commercial electrical repair is essential for businesses is to comply with building codes and regulations. Electrical systems in commercial buildings are subject to strict guidelines set forth by governing bodies at the local, state, and federal levels. Failure to meet these requirements can result in fines, penalties, and even forced closures. By staying up to date on electrical repairs and upgrades, businesses can ensure that they remain in compliance with all relevant regulations and avoid potential legal issues.
